A death investigation is underway after a man was found shot in the head in a park in Lawrence Monday morning, authorities said.
Officers responding to a call at Riverfront State Park on Everett Street shortly before 12:30 p.m. found a 27-year-old man with a gunshot wound to the head, according to Essex District Attorney Paul Tucker and the police chief. by Lawrence, Melix Bonilla.
The victim, whose name was not released, was pronounced dead at the scene.
Tucker and Bonilla made no mention of any arrests related to the shooting.
The Essex County Massachusetts State Police Detective Unit is assisting the Lawrence Police Department in the investigation.

This shooting happened just hours after a 17-year-old boy was shot and killed on Brook Street in Lawrence.
